To prevent sticking, bifold doors are designed to be ever-so slightly smaller than the frame. However, this could cause air to leak in through the gap. To stop this from happening, install a weather seal.

Damaged Seals

A bifold door's ability to seamlessly transition between outdoor and indoor spaces depends on its seals and weather stripping. When these components fail they can create drafts, lower energy efficiency, and allow water to enter the home. The first sign of deterioration is generally a visible gap when the doors are closed, or drafts when they're opened.

While the process of deterioration is natural and inevitable over time, there are a number of preventative measures you can adopt to extend the lifespan of your doors and keep them in good working condition for as long as possible. You can clean the runners and track of your doors frequently to remove dirt. Depending on where you reside and the climate, this might be required every few weeks or once a week.

It's also a good idea to inspect the drain holes in your sills regularly. This will ensure that rainwater or any other moisture isn't collecting in the sills and cause damage or corrosion. It's also important to shut and open your bifold doors on a regular basis to keep the hardware from freezing. If your bifold doors don't get opened and closed frequently they may begin to develop issues that can be costly to fix.

If your bifold door is difficult to open, or seems stuck it's possible that the hinges or locks are out of alignment. This is a simple fix and can be rectified by loosening the door hinge bolts and adjusting them until they are in alignment with the frame.

If your doors are leaking or letting in a draft it's likely that the weather stripping or seals have become damaged and must be replaced. Replacing these parts will improve your bifold door's functionality and enhance its ability to protect your home. Dirty Tracks

The runners and tracks of your bifold doors must to be kept clear of sand, dirt and anything else that may hinder their smooth operation. If you don't do this often, your door will grind or stick. You'll need to clean your track when this happens. It's a simple procedure. Make use of a vacuum cleaner attachment to clean the track. This is best carried out on a regular basis when the doors are in regular use.

Glass-Replacement-150x150.jpgIt is important to make sure that the drainage holes on your bifold door aren't blocked, especially if you live in a coastal area where salt deposits can damage your bifold door and frame. It is crucial to clean these holes to prevent rainwater leaking into your home, causing problems like rusting and water damage.

If your bifold door is making a scratching sound when it opens, it's likely to be something caught in the track. To fix this first, make sure the track is clear of any stones or other debris. Then, you can lubricate it.

If you're looking for a great grease for your bifold doors, then WD40 is the best option. It can be used on metal and plastic. This makes it perfect to run your doors. This will help to keep them in good shape and running smoothly for many years to be.

Loose Hinges

If your bifold doors don't open easily, there could be a blockage that prevents them from opening fully or forming a tight seal with the frame of the door. Checking for any dirt, debris or other blockages is a good place to start. If you find anything that is hindering your doors from sliding, you can clean and lubricate it to return them to a smooth, quiet operation.

The hinges on your bifold doors could be an area of potential trouble, particularly if they're dropping. This could be caused by a few things such as broken screw holes or worn hinge pins. In some cases, this can be fixed by using a drill to take out the screw that is broken and filling the hole with wood glue. After it has dried, the hinge will be able to be re-attached to the frame of the door.

It's not uncommon for new doors to require minor adjustments and maintenance. This is typically an easy and affordable process. You can adjust your pivot brackets to better align your doors. If your doors are sliding or are not aligned properly on the floor, you can fix them by loosening screws and manipulating them.

Sometimes, a change in flooring or the addition of carpeting could cause a set of existing bifold doors to rub against the track. This can be fixed by loosening the screws that hold the pivot bracket and then raising or lowering it to the right height. It's important to make small adjustments, and then test the doors until you find a position that is working.

Broken Hardware

As time passes, the hardware of a bifolding door may become loose or even break. Certain of these issues are fixable with basic tools and a bit of patience. If your bifold doors are falling off their track constantly It could be time to replace them.

Bifold doors can crack around the guides or hinges because they are made from lightweight materials. It is essential to regularly oil these parts to ensure they are running smoothly and to avoid breaking and cracking. Also, you should check them for signs of wear and tear and replace or repair any worn out parts as soon as possible.

Adjusting the pivot brackets is usually the easiest way to fix sagging bifold doors or ones that scrape the floor. You can adjust the bottom bracket by raising it a bit, loosening its set screw so that it moves up or down or placing shims underneath it. The top pivot can be adjusted by loosing and rotating the adjustment nut counterclockwise.

You should also examine the height of your pivot pins as well as guides regularly. This will stop them from falling down or becoming crooked, which makes it difficult to open and shut.

Another common problem with bifold doors is that they can begin to lose their shape after years of usage. This makes them difficult to close and open, and can cause the guides to slide out of the head track. This can be corrected by resetting them inside the track or altering the anchor pin.
